Output 07c1ae95598427bf5fe1816f70d1650ce3f682e75f8d7d023362671bc3ca3de8:1

value
423023677
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 562fef38ca49f0e35557c7369a288fd281fffdc5 OP_EQUALVERIFY OP_CHECKSIG
address
18riY3SeQBwMrSfekUwg66CqWfyYsj5gx6
transaction
07c1ae95598427bf5fe1816f70d1650ce3f682e75f8d7d023362671bc3ca3de8
spent
true